【问题描述】
将MySQL的数据转移到另外一台服务器。所以将原MySQL数据库备份为 *.sql*格式的,在导入另外一台服务器的MySQL时,就出现了“ERROR 2006 (HY000) at line xx: MySQL server has gone away”这样的错误!究其原因:是因为原数据库里面包含了较大数据包,而新的数据库还没有进行配置而导致的。
【解决方案】
找到 my.cnf/my.ini 文件,在 [mysqld] 节点下面,增加下面三行代码(主要是第一行)
max_allowed_packet=20M
wait_timeout=2880000
interactive_timeout=2880000
文章转载自dblife,如果涉嫌侵权,请发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。




